Lots of spring breakers along the southern coastline the days. Especially in Florida. And yesterday they received a surprise hail storm in Panama City Beach. A cluster of severe storms swept across Southern states early Saturday, destroying buildings in the Florida Panhandle and dropping large hail on a coastal Alabama city. In Panama City Beach, Florida, a home and convenience store were leveled by a possible tornado, city officials reported. A resident’s photo posted by The Panama City News Herald shows the store’s roof and walls ripped away, but its counters, shelves and the merchandise they held appear untouched. There were no immediate reports of injuries. Images shared by news outlets showed car windshields shattered by hail about as large as baseballs in Orange Beach, Alabama. Storms also brought heavy rain and strong winds to parts of Louisiana and Mississippi. Some flooding was reported. Several thousand customers lost power overnight, according to a utility tracking website. These storms can come up without any notice. A very dangerous time. I hope everyone stays safe.
